Understanding the Logistics: Why Fresh Meal Delivery to Alaska Is Challenging

The reason for the lack of Fresh N Lean meals in Alaska lies in the very nature of their product offering—fresh, non-frozen meals that must remain chilled from preparation to consumption.

The Cold Chain Challenge

Fresh meal delivery relies on a cold chain—a temperature-controlled supply chain that ensures food stays at optimal conditions during transit. For cold chain logistics to work efficiently:

  • Temperature-controlled vehicles must be used for local and regional deliveries
  • Timely transport is essential to prevent spoilage
  • Real-time tracking and delivery scheduling are needed to ensure meals arrive as promised

Alaska lacks the same breadth of cold chain infrastructure as the contiguous United States. While FedEx and other shippers can transport perishable goods, the consistency and cost associated with shipping fresh meals across such a vast distance make it impractical for companies like Fresh N Lean—especially when they’re competing with established frozen meal services that have already solved the logistics puzzle.

Time Sensitivity and Shelf Life

Fresh N Lean meals have a refrigerated shelf life of up to 7 days. If it takes 2–3 days to reach customers in the contiguous U.S., that leaves plenty of time to enjoy the meals.

However, in Alaska:

  • Estimated delivery time can be 3–5 days depending on location
  • Long delivery windows increase the risk of spoilage
  • Delays due to weather—common in Alaska—can further complicate delivery reliability

This makes fresh meal delivery to Alaska a challenge not easily overcome without significant infrastructure investments or a local kitchen facility.
